Another common problem is poor grinding quality. In industries such as cement production and chemical engineering, the fineness and uniformity of the powder directly affect the quality of the final product. If the grinding equipment fails to achieve the required fineness, it can lead to sub – standard products, which in turn may cause customer complaints and loss of market share. Imagine a cement factory that produces cement with inconsistent particle sizes. The concrete made from this cement may have weak structural strength, posing a threat to construction safety.
